xiuxiu.htm
2018-02-08 10:32 更新
<!--{template common/header_simple_start}-->
<script src="http://open.web.meitu.com/sources/xiuxiu.js" type="text/javascript"></script>
<style type="text/css">
html, body {
height: 100%;
overflow: hidden;
}
body {
margin: 0;
}
</style>
<script type="text/javascript">
window.onload=function(){
xiuxiu.params.wmode = "transparent";
xiuxiu.setLaunchVars("preventBrowseDefault", 1);
xiuxiu.setLaunchVars("preventUploadDefault", 1);
xiuxiu.embedSWF("altContent",3,"100%","100%");
/*第1个参数是加载编辑器div容器,第2个参数是编辑器类型,第3个参数是div容器宽,第4个参数是div容器高*/
xiuxiu.onInit = function (){
if('{$stream}') xiuxiu.loadPhoto("{$stream}");
xiuxiu.setUploadURL("{$_G[siteurl]}"+DZZSCRIPT+"?mod=xiuxiu&do=save");//修改为您自己的上传接收图片程序
xiuxiu.setUploadType (1);
}
xiuxiu.onUploadResponse = function (data){
try{
var data1=eval('(' + data + ')')
parent._ico.createIco(data1);
}catch(e){}
}
xiuxiu.onBeforeUpload = function(data, id) {
return true;
}
xiuxiu.onBrowse = function (channel, multipleSelection, canClose, id){
/*调用桌面文件接口,打开桌面文件*/
parent.OpenFile('open','打开文件',{image:['图像(*.jpg,*.jpeg,*.png,*.gif)',['IMAGE','JPG','JPEG','PNG','GIF'],'']},{bz:'all',multiple:multipleSelection},function(data){
var datas=[];
if(data.params.multiple){
datas=data.icodata
}else{
datas=[data.icodata];
}
var images=[];
for(var i in datas){
if(data.params.ishref){ //文件为远程图片网址
images.push(encodeURI(datas[i].url));
}else{ //桌面图片
images.push(encodeURI(SITEURL+DZZSCRIPT+'?mod=io&op=thumbnail&path='+datas[i].dpath+'&original=1'));
}
}
xiuxiu.loadPhoto(images,false,id,{loadImageChannel: channel});
});
return true;
}
<!--{if $_G['uid']}-->
xiuxiu.onUpload = function(id) {
/*调用桌面文件接口,保存图片到桌面*/
parent.OpenFile('saveto','保存图像',{image:['图像(*.jpg,*.jpeg,*.png,*.gif)',['IMAGE','JPG','JPEG','PNG','GIF'],'selected']},{bz:'all',multiple:false,'name':'metu.jpg'},function(data){
xiuxiu.setUploadArgs({path:encodeURIComponent(data.position), name:encodeURIComponent(data.name),tpath:data.icodata?encodeURIComponent(data.icodata.path):''});
xiuxiu.upload();
});
}
<!--{/if}-->
}
</script>
<!--{template common/header_simple_end}-->
<div id="altContent">
<h1>美图秀秀</h1>
</div>
<!--{template common/footer_simple}-->
<script src="http://open.web.meitu.com/sources/xiuxiu.js" type="text/javascript"></script>
<style type="text/css">
html, body {
height: 100%;
overflow: hidden;
}
body {
margin: 0;
}
</style>
<script type="text/javascript">
window.onload=function(){
xiuxiu.params.wmode = "transparent";
xiuxiu.setLaunchVars("preventBrowseDefault", 1);
xiuxiu.setLaunchVars("preventUploadDefault", 1);
xiuxiu.embedSWF("altContent",3,"100%","100%");
/*第1个参数是加载编辑器div容器,第2个参数是编辑器类型,第3个参数是div容器宽,第4个参数是div容器高*/
xiuxiu.onInit = function (){
if('{$stream}') xiuxiu.loadPhoto("{$stream}");
xiuxiu.setUploadURL("{$_G[siteurl]}"+DZZSCRIPT+"?mod=xiuxiu&do=save");//修改为您自己的上传接收图片程序
xiuxiu.setUploadType (1);
}
xiuxiu.onUploadResponse = function (data){
try{
var data1=eval('(' + data + ')')
parent._ico.createIco(data1);
}catch(e){}
}
xiuxiu.onBeforeUpload = function(data, id) {
return true;
}
xiuxiu.onBrowse = function (channel, multipleSelection, canClose, id){
/*调用桌面文件接口,打开桌面文件*/
parent.OpenFile('open','打开文件',{image:['图像(*.jpg,*.jpeg,*.png,*.gif)',['IMAGE','JPG','JPEG','PNG','GIF'],'']},{bz:'all',multiple:multipleSelection},function(data){
var datas=[];
if(data.params.multiple){
datas=data.icodata
}else{
datas=[data.icodata];
}
var images=[];
for(var i in datas){
if(data.params.ishref){ //文件为远程图片网址
images.push(encodeURI(datas[i].url));
}else{ //桌面图片
images.push(encodeURI(SITEURL+DZZSCRIPT+'?mod=io&op=thumbnail&path='+datas[i].dpath+'&original=1'));
}
}
xiuxiu.loadPhoto(images,false,id,{loadImageChannel: channel});
});
return true;
}
<!--{if $_G['uid']}-->
xiuxiu.onUpload = function(id) {
/*调用桌面文件接口,保存图片到桌面*/
parent.OpenFile('saveto','保存图像',{image:['图像(*.jpg,*.jpeg,*.png,*.gif)',['IMAGE','JPG','JPEG','PNG','GIF'],'selected']},{bz:'all',multiple:false,'name':'metu.jpg'},function(data){
xiuxiu.setUploadArgs({path:encodeURIComponent(data.position), name:encodeURIComponent(data.name),tpath:data.icodata?encodeURIComponent(data.icodata.path):''});
xiuxiu.upload();
});
}
<!--{/if}-->
}
</script>
<!--{template common/header_simple_end}-->
<div id="altContent">
<h1>美图秀秀</h1>
</div>
<!--{template common/footer_simple}-->
以上内容是否对您有帮助:
更多建议: